Heavy rain is expected to bring flooding and disruption across large parts of the UK on Monday.

An amber Met Office severe weather warning for rain is in force across south Wales, while multiple yellow warnings are in force for many western areas of the UK.

As much as a month's worth of rain will fall in a day onto already very saturated ground.

There will also be some gusty winds, especially around coastal areas.

Winter - meteorologically speaking - has started on a very wet note with rain across much of the UK.

That trend is likely to continue for most of Monday and turn particularly heavy at times.

Rainfall totals will build quite widely but with very saturated ground there are numerous yellow Met Office warnings in force.

A more severe amber Met Office warning is in force for south Wales until 23:59 GMT.

Between 20 and 40mm (0.8 and 1.6in) of rain is expected to fall widely here, with some south-western facing hills seeing nearer to 120mm (4.7in).

This would mean a month's worth of rain would fall in just one day.

Extensive flooding is possible along with disruption on the road and rail network, loss of power and communities potentially cut off.

The Met Office has also warned that fast flowing or deep floodwater is possible, causing a danger to life.

Additionally, yellow Met Office weather warnings are in force for:

  • South-west Scotland until 21:00 on Monday

  • North-west England and parts of the West Midlands until 03:00 on Tuesday

  • Most of Wales and south-west England until 03:00 on Tuesday

Again, between 20 and 40mm of rain is forecast to fall quite widely but some areas, such as the higher ground of the Cumbrian Fells and Eyri, could see between 80 and 120mm (3 and 4.7in).

This too could bring some localised flooding and transport disruption.

Flood warnings have been issued by the Environment Agency and Natural Resources Wales.

Strong winds will also accompany the heavy rain, with gales possible around coasts and over high ground.
